class ClockProperties
Defined at line 780 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
Public Methods
void ClockProperties ()
Defined at line 782 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
void ClockProperties (const ClockProperties & other)
Defined at line 783 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
ClockProperties & operator= (const ClockProperties & other)
Defined at line 784 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
void ClockProperties (ClockProperties && other)
Defined at line 785 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
bool IsEmpty ()
Returns whether no field is set.
bool HasUnknownData ()
Returns whether the table references unknown fields.
::fidl::WireTableBuilder< ::fuchsia_virtualaudio::wire::ClockProperties> Builder (::fidl::AnyArena & arena)
Return a builder that by defaults allocates of an arena.
::fidl::WireTableExternalBuilder< ::fuchsia_virtualaudio::wire::ClockProperties> ExternalBuilder (::fidl::ObjectView< ::fidl::WireTableFrame< ::fuchsia_virtualaudio::wire::ClockProperties>> frame)
Return a builder that relies on explicitly allocating |fidl::ObjectView|s.
int32_t & domain ()
The clock domain is an int32 provided by the clock tree to an audio
driver. special values for `CLOCK_DOMAIN_MONOTONIC` (0), and
`CLOCK_DOMAIN_EXTERNAL` (-1) (not locally controllable) are defined in
`fuchsia.hardware.audio`. Note: other than -1, clients should treat any
negative `clock_domain` value as invalid.
Optional.
bool has_domain ()
ClockProperties & operator= (ClockProperties && other)
Defined at line 786 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
int32_t & rate_adjustment_ppm ()
Rate-adjustment value for this clock. If omitted, treated as 0 ppm.
Optional.
bool has_rate_adjustment_ppm ()
void ~ClockProperties ()
Defined at line 788 of file fidling/gen/sdk/fidl/fuchsia.virtualaudio/fuchsia.virtualaudio/cpp/fidl/fuchsia.virtualaudio/cpp/wire_types.h
Friends
class WireTableBaseBuilder
class WireTableBaseBuilder